An Albury shopper could have 2.2 million reasons to celebrate today – as soon as they check their ticket from Saturday Lotto’s $20 million Superdraw and discover they have won division one!
 
There were nine division one winning entries across Australia in Saturday Lotto draw 3873 on 1 September 2018. Each entry won a division one prize of $2,222,222.23.
 
The winning Albury entry was purchased at newsXpress Lavington Square Cards & Gift, Lavington Square, 351 Griffith Road, Lavington.
 
NSW Lotteries spokesperson Matt Hart said the division-one-winning entry was not registered to a Players Club card, so he had no way of contacting the winner to break the life-changing news.
 
“If you bought a ticket in Saturday Lotto’s $20 million Superdraw from newsXpress Lavington Square Cards & Gift, we urge you to check it now! You could be our mystery division one winner!
 
“If you discover you are holding the division one winning ticket, contact NSW Lotteries on 131 868 to begin the process of claiming your prize.”
 
NewsXpress Lavington Square Cards & Lotto staff member Lindsay Golding said he was eagerly waiting to deliver the news to one of his customers.
 
“Someone out there has won,” he said.
 
“We sold a lot of gift packs for Father’s Day so perhaps it was in one of those and it’s sitting out there waiting to be checked and claimed.”
 
So far this calendar year, Monday & Wednesday Lotto and Saturday Lotto have created 128 millionaires across Australia.
 
The winning numbers in Saturday Lotto draw 3873 on Saturday 1 September 2018 were 36, 16, 14, 10, 43 and 5, while the supplementary numbers were 19 and 18.
 
Across Australia there were nine division one winning entries in Saturday Lotto draw 3873 – three each from Victoria and New South Wales, and one each from Queensland, Western Australia and South Australia.
 
The Lott’s division one winning tally has now reached 275 so far this calendar year, including 72 won by NSW Lotteries customers.
 
Last financial year, there were 290 division one winning Saturday Lotto entries across the Lott’s jurisdictions, which collectively won more than $302.7 million.
